EXCEEDS logo
Exceeds
Kan Zhang

PROFILE

Kan Zhang

Over eleven months, contributed to onflow/flow-go and onflow/flow by building and refining backend infrastructure for blockchain transaction processing, authentication, and DeFi workflows. Developed features such as standardized API serialization, robust WebAuthn-based authentication, and multi-account wallet support, emphasizing code maintainability and security. Enhanced transaction signature models and integrated ExtensionData handling across Go and TypeScript codebases, while improving test coverage and CI reliability. Managed dependencies and documentation to support audit readiness, mainnet deployment, and infrastructure cost optimization. Leveraged Go, Protocol Buffers, and REST APIs to deliver scalable, production-ready solutions, aligning sprint planning and governance with evolving project and ecosystem requirements.

Overall Statistics

Feature vs Bugs

93%Features

Repository Contributions

82Total
Bugs
2
Commits
82
Features
27
Lines of code
3,962
Activity Months11

Work History

January 2026

1 Commits • 1 Features

Jan 1, 2026

January 2026 monthly summary for onflow/flow focused on governance-driven infrastructure planning and documentation improvements. Key feature delivered: Sprint Kickoff Infrastructure Management Update. The sprint kickoff doc was updated to reflect completed tasks and new objectives for infrastructure management, emphasizing cost optimization and historical node management. No major bugs fixed this month. Overall impact: strengthened governance and planning alignment between infrastructure initiatives and sprint goals, improved cost visibility, and established a foundation for scalable node management and historical tracking. This prepares the team for more predictable releases and better budgeting in future sprints. Technologies/skills demonstrated: documentation governance, version-controlled changelogs, risk-aware planning, cost optimization considerations, and infrastructure management insights.

December 2025

1 Commits • 1 Features

Dec 1, 2025

December 2025 monthly summary for onflow/flow focusing on business value and technical achievements. Key deliverable: Flow ALP and Flow Vaults Planning and Integration Roadmap in the repository. Updated sprint kickoff documentation to capture new objectives and tasks around audit readiness, transaction scheduling, and EVM integration. No major bugs fixed this month; stability maintained as groundwork was laid for upcoming features.

November 2025

1 Commits • 1 Features

Nov 1, 2025

November 2025 monthly summary focusing on sprint kickoff and release readiness for Flow ALP and Flow Vaults. Major activity centered on updating the Sprint Kickoff documentation to reflect current status and objectives, including deployment steps and upcoming features. This work improved release readiness, cross-team alignment, and stakeholder visibility ahead of Flow ALP and Flow Vaults deployments. No customer-facing bug fixes were recorded this month; the emphasis was planning and documentation to reduce release risk and accelerate upcoming sprints.

October 2025

3 Commits • 2 Features

Oct 1, 2025

Month 2025-10 summary: Focused on governance readiness for the Tidal initiative and advancing mainnet deployment readiness for FlowALP and Flow Vaults. Delivered sprint planning artifacts and updated kickoff agendas, capturing action items on liquidation logic, testnet integration, and oracle integration to guide October workstreams. Progress on FlowALP deployment to Mainnet and updates to Flow Vaults demonstrates solid integration work and alignment with the product roadmap. Overall impact: improved governance discipline, clearer execution plans, and stronger foundation for production readiness. Skills demonstrated include sprint planning, documentation discipline, cross-team collaboration, commit-based traceability, and end-to-end deployment readiness planning. This work sets the stage for reliable production releases and faster value delivery to ecosystem partners.

September 2025

9 Commits • 4 Features

Sep 1, 2025

September 2025 monthly summary for onflow/flow and onflow/flow-go. Focused on sprint planning alignment, code quality, dependency management, and test reliability. Delivered: updated Sprint Kickoff agenda for Tidal project; code cleanup removing unused Transaction methods; clearer crypto error messaging and generalization of not-supported hashing error; dependency upgrades to flow-go-sdk v1.8.1 and related modules; improvements to test reliability addressing timing-related flakiness and test harness adjustments. These work items reduce maintenance risk, improve CI stability, and position the projects for smoother testnet deployment and continued Oracles/AMMs integration. Technologies demonstrated include Go, dependency management, code refactoring, error handling, test engineering, and documentation assistance for sprint processes.

August 2025

21 Commits • 4 Features

Aug 1, 2025

August 2025 monthly summary: Delivered critical features, strengthened data integrity, and reinforced security across onflow/flow and onflow/flow-go. Key outcomes include sprint kickoff improvements, robust ExtensionData handling for Access API, centralized WebAuthn extension data signing/validation, and proactive maintenance to keep dependencies current. These efforts reduce risk, improve developer velocity, and deliver tangible business value for DeFi workflows and Tidal initiatives.

July 2025

6 Commits • 2 Features

Jul 1, 2025

July 2025 monthly summary for onflow/flow-go and onflow/flow. Focused on stabilizing the ecosystem through strategic dependency management and aligning planning for DeFi initiatives. Delivered concrete updates to dependencies, Go module hygiene, and sprint planning processes that unlock faster, more secure delivery while keeping audits and production readiness in mind.

June 2025

6 Commits • 3 Features

Jun 1, 2025

June 2025 monthly summary highlighting key technical accomplishments and business value delivered across two core Flow repositories (onflow/flow-go and onflow/flow). The month focused on enhancing transaction integrity, strengthening testing coverage, documenting and preparing for beta programs, and improving reliability for critical flows used by customers and partners.

May 2025

14 Commits • 5 Features

May 1, 2025

May 2025 delivered security, extensibility, and onboarding improvements across onflow/flow-go and onflow/flow. Core changes include extending the transaction signature data model with ExtensionData across core, crypto verification, and REST API; WebAuthn reliability improvements with expanded test coverage; a dependency upgrade to Flow protobuf v0.4.11 to stay aligned with latest definitions; and new wallet capabilities supporting multiple accounts, plus protocol-level extension_data for Transaction_Signature. These efforts lay groundwork for more robust authentication, easier backend integration, and scalable multi-account workflows, with measurable business value in security, developer velocity, and on-chain tooling readiness.

April 2025

19 Commits • 3 Features

Apr 1, 2025

April 2025: Strengthened security and reliability through WebAuthn-based authentication and extended transaction verification in flow-go, improved test coverage and data-model refinements, enhanced transfer action logging and observability in latency-test, and stabilized CI by standardizing default RPC endpoints and test runner configuration. These efforts deliver stronger user authentication, safer transaction processing, clearer debugging signals, and more predictable release pipelines.

March 2025

1 Commits • 1 Features

Mar 1, 2025

March 2025 Monthly Summary – onflow/flow-go Overview: Focused on API standardization for final-state serialization to improve consistency, reliability, and maintainability in the BlockSeal Build workflow. The month delivered a targeted, design-quality feature that unifies how StateCommitment is rendered as a string, reducing boilerplate and potential serialization drift across components. Key outcomes: Enhanced serialization pathway, clearer API contract for StateCommitment, and groundwork for easier onboarding for new contributors through a simpler, consistent code path.

Activity

Loading activity data...

Quality Metrics

Correctness92.6%
Maintainability91.4%
Architecture88.2%
Performance88.0%
AI Usage21.6%

Skills & Technologies

Programming Languages

GoMarkdownTypeScriptgoprotobuf

Technical Skills

API DesignAPI DevelopmentAPI IntegrationAPI TestingBackend DevelopmentBlockchain DevelopmentCode CleanupCode LintingCode RefactoringCode RenamingCryptographyData ModelingDebuggingDependency ManagementDocumentation

Repositories Contributed To

3 repos

Overview of all repositories you've contributed to across your timeline

onflow/flow-go

Mar 2025 Sep 2025
7 Months active

Languages Used

Go

Technical Skills

API DevelopmentBackend DevelopmentCode RenamingCryptographyData ModelingError Handling

onflow/flow

May 2025 Jan 2026
9 Months active

Languages Used

Markdowngoprotobuf

Technical Skills

DocumentationProject Managementbackend developmentprotobufblockchain integrationdocumentation

onflow/flow-latency-test

Apr 2025 Apr 2025
1 Month active

Languages Used

TypeScript

Technical Skills

Backend DevelopmentDebuggingEnvironment ConfigurationFull Stack DevelopmentLoggingTesting